public interface IRuleRules are used for analyzing flight recordings and creating results that can inform a user about problems.The key method to implement is
evaluate(IItemCollection, IPreferenceValueProvider).getId()must return an id that is unique for each implementation andgetName()should return a human readable name.Rule instances may be reused for multiple evaluations with different input data so it is recommended that they are stateless.

Method Detail
-
evaluate
java.util.concurrent.RunnableFuture<Result> evaluate(IItemCollection items, IPreferenceValueProvider valueProvider)
Gets a future representing the result of the evaluation of this rule. Running the RunnableFuture is the responsibility of the caller of this method, not the implementation.- Parameters:
items- items to evaluatevalueProvider- Provider of configuration values used for evaluation. The attributes that will be asked for from the provider should be provided bygetConfigurationAttributes().- Returns:
- a RunnableFuture that when run will return the evaluation result
-
getConfigurationAttributes
java.util.Collection<TypedPreference<?>> getConfigurationAttributes()
Gets information about which attributes may be configured during rule evaluation.- Returns:
- a list of configuration attributes
